应用系统运维管理中的安全防护措施有哪些?
在当今信息化时代,应用系统运维管理已经成为企业信息化建设的重要组成部分。然而,随着网络攻击手段的不断升级,应用系统的安全防护问题日益凸显。为了确保应用系统的稳定运行,以下将详细介绍应用系统运维管理中的安全防护措施。
一、网络安全防护
- 防火墙策略
防火墙是网络安全的第一道防线,通过对进出网络的流量进行监控和过滤,防止恶意攻击。企业应根据自身业务需求,制定合理的防火墙策略,包括:
- 访问控制策略:限制内部网络与外部网络的通信,防止未经授权的访问。
- 端口过滤策略:关闭不必要的端口,减少攻击面。
- 安全规则策略:设置入侵检测、防病毒、防木马等安全规则。
- 入侵检测与防御系统(IDS/IPS)
入侵检测与防御系统可以实时监控网络流量,发现并阻止恶意攻击。企业应选择合适的IDS/IPS产品,并定期更新规则库,提高检测和防御能力。
- 漏洞扫描与修复
定期对应用系统进行漏洞扫描,发现潜在的安全隐患,并及时修复。企业可利用漏洞扫描工具,对操作系统、数据库、中间件等关键组件进行扫描,确保系统安全。
二、系统安全防护
- 操作系统安全
操作系统是应用系统的基石,其安全性直接影响到整个系统的安全。企业应选择安全可靠的操作系统,并定期更新补丁,关闭不必要的系统服务,降低攻击风险。
- 数据库安全
数据库是存储企业核心数据的地方,其安全性至关重要。企业应采取以下措施:
- 访问控制:设置合理的用户权限,限制对数据库的访问。
- 数据加密:对敏感数据进行加密存储,防止数据泄露。
- 备份与恢复:定期备份数据库,确保数据安全。
- 中间件安全
中间件是连接应用系统和数据库的桥梁,其安全性对整个系统至关重要。企业应选择安全可靠的中间件产品,并定期更新补丁,关闭不必要的功能。
三、应用安全防护
- 代码安全
企业应加强代码安全意识,采用安全的编程规范,避免常见的安全漏洞,如SQL注入、XSS攻击等。
- 身份认证与授权
应用系统应采用安全的身份认证与授权机制,确保用户身份的合法性。企业可利用以下技术:
- 双因素认证:结合密码和动态令牌,提高认证安全性。
- OAuth2.0:实现第三方应用的授权访问。
- 安全审计
企业应定期进行安全审计,对应用系统的安全状况进行全面检查,及时发现并解决安全隐患。
案例分析:
某企业应用系统遭受了一次SQL注入攻击,导致大量用户数据泄露。经调查发现,该企业未对数据库进行安全配置,导致攻击者轻易获取了数据库访问权限。针对此案例,企业应采取以下措施:
- 对数据库进行安全配置,限制访问权限。
- 定期进行漏洞扫描,发现并修复潜在的安全隐患。
- 加强员工安全意识培训,提高安全防护能力。
总结:
应用系统运维管理中的安全防护措施是确保系统稳定运行的关键。企业应根据自身业务需求,制定合理的安全策略,并采取有效措施,提高应用系统的安全性。
猜你喜欢:可观测性平台